Beautiful listed building in Sussex
This delightful property is situated within 2 acres of land. A large natural pond lies behind the house. The garden and surrounding land had become overgrown...the 'Sleeping beauty' was in need of awakening!
- To visually reconnect the house and lake.
- To open up the overgrown garden.
- To create an easier-to-maintain garden.
- This project is on going but the results are already evident.
- The image of the house reflected in the lake once more says it all!

"Over a 20 year period our garden had quietly grown into a jungle of huge hedges, thick thickets, tall trees and a disappearing pond - until one summer’s day last year Mary Stevenson came to our rescue.
She strode into the middle of our field of 5ft nettles, exuding good humour, enthusiasm and creativity and after several months of site meetings and consultations, she designed a major plan of action to transform every aspect of the garden - restoring the pond, building a patio area, creating a sweeping drive, introducing colour, scent and texture in low maintenance flower beds and returning the land to its natural contours.
Mary and her lovely team of contractors guided and supported us throughout the entire landscaping process, and nine months later, our property looks so different that visitors have actually driven straight past!
Importantly too, a recent valuation has confirmed that landscaping the garden has added as much as 10% to the value of our house. We are getting so much pleasure from the haven Mary has created for us - we are very grateful to her."
